What exactly are these intriguing features? They are properly known as buds. Each bud holds the potential to sprout, to develop into a new potato plant. This is nature’s clever mechanism for reproduction, a built-in system for ensuring the species’ survival. These “eyes” are dormant shoots, patiently waiting for the right conditions to awaken and unleash their growth potential.

The potato itself is a marvel of botanical design. It’s a modified stem, an underground storage organ, engineered for survival and propagation. Think of the potato’s skin as its protective outer layer. It shields the softer flesh within from the harsh realities of the soil, maintaining its moisture and protecting it from potential damage. The flesh itself is a reservoir of starch, a concentrated energy source providing sustenance to the developing plant. The entire structure is finely tuned to sustain the potato, ensuring its ability to reproduce and continue to provide nourishment to any creature that finds it.

While other root vegetables, like carrots and beets, offer their own nutritional benefits, the potato’s “eyes” distinguish it. Carrots and beets are propagated from seeds. They don’t possess these ready-made, dormant buds that unlock a quick path to a new plant. This ability to readily reproduce is a key part of the potato’s success and a significant factor in its global popularity.

The Amazing Function of the Eyes: A Powerhouse of Propagation

How the Eyes Propagate

The potato’s eyes are its secret weapon. They are the key to easy propagation. The dormant buds residing within each eye hold the potential to give rise to a whole new generation of potato plants. The potato’s ability to propagate itself, almost effortlessly, distinguishes it from many other vegetables, and it is this very characteristic that makes it such a rewarding plant to cultivate.

The sprouting process is a fascinating dance between dormancy and growth. The potato remains in a resting state until the right environmental conditions are met. What exactly triggers the “eyes” to awaken? Moisture is critical. A moist environment provides the necessary hydration for the buds to begin developing. Warmth is also crucial; it kickstarts the metabolic processes within the bud. And finally, the presence of light, once the sprout breaks the surface of the soil, initiates photosynthesis, the energy-making process that fuels the plant’s growth.

Cultivating potatoes makes clever use of the “eyes” in various ways. A single seed potato can produce multiple new plants. Gardeners often cut the potato into pieces, each piece containing at least one or two eyes. These pieces are then planted in the soil, and each eye, given the right conditions, will sprout and grow into a new potato plant. This method of planting, or “chitting,” is a simple yet effective method of increasing yield and ensuring the continued proliferation of the harvest.

The role of the “eyes” is integral to the potato plant’s life cycle. Once planted, the “eyes” awaken, sending forth shoots and roots. The shoots emerge from the soil, developing stems and leaves that capture sunlight and generate energy through photosynthesis. This energy is then channeled down to the underground stems, where new potatoes begin to form. The “eyes” are, in effect, the starting points for the next generation, providing the seed material. When the leaves begin to yellow and wither, it is often a sign that the potatoes beneath the soil have reached maturity and are ready to be harvested, perpetuating the circle of life.

Cultivating Potatoes: Putting the Eyes to Work

Steps to Planting Potatoes

Growing potatoes, guided by the “eyes”, is a rewarding experience, perfect for both the novice and the experienced gardener. Preparing your garden, selecting the right seed potatoes, and providing the right growing conditions are key steps to achieving a bountiful harvest. The simple act of planting the potatoes with care can transform a backyard into a verdant haven.

Before you even think about planting, good soil preparation is key. Potatoes thrive in well-drained, loose soil that is rich in organic matter. Loosen the soil well, adding compost or other organic amendments to improve its texture and fertility. The depth and spacing of the planting are also important. Ideally, you’ll plant your seed potatoes approximately four to six inches deep, spaced about a foot apart. This allows ample room for the plants to grow and prevents overcrowding, while still allowing for high yields.

Choosing the right seed potatoes is critical. Look for certified seed potatoes, which are disease-free and specifically grown for planting. Seed potatoes with numerous “eyes” are usually preferable, as they can yield more plants. Cut the potatoes into pieces, ensuring that each piece contains at least one or two healthy eyes. Allow the cut pieces to dry and callous over for a day or two before planting. This step helps reduce the risk of rot.

The environment also plays a crucial role in successful potato cultivation. Potatoes need plenty of sunlight to develop properly, ideally at least six to eight hours per day. They also require consistent watering, especially during the growing season. However, be careful not to overwater, as this can lead to root rot. Mulching around the plants helps retain moisture, suppress weeds, and regulate soil temperature. Potatoes also benefit from regular fertilizing, using a balanced fertilizer specifically designed for root vegetables.

Knowing when to harvest your potatoes is an important part of the process. The right time to harvest can usually be recognized when the potato plants start to flower and the foliage begins to yellow and wither. Gently dig around the base of the plants to locate the potatoes. Using a garden fork is ideal, so you can be careful not to puncture the potatoes. Once the potatoes are dug up, let them dry in a shady location before storing them.

Beyond the Garden: The Global Significance of Potatoes

Potatoes Around the World

The humble potato’s impact extends far beyond the backyard garden. Its contribution to human civilization is immense. The potato’s role in history, nutrition, and culinary arts is a testament to its enduring relevance in the world.

The potato is a nutritional powerhouse, loaded with essential vitamins, minerals, and carbohydrates. It’s a good source of vitamin C, potassium, and fiber. It provides sustained energy, a key element in human health and well-being. This high nutritional value, combined with its relative ease of cultivation, has made the potato a valuable food source for centuries.

Historically, the potato played a vital role in mitigating famine and supporting population growth. In Ireland, for example, the potato’s cultivation became inextricably linked to the country’s survival. Its relatively easy propagation and high yields allowed the population to thrive. The potato’s impact is still seen today.

The potato’s presence in global cuisines is simply astounding. From the classic French fries to the hearty potato dishes of Eastern Europe, the versatile root vegetable is the basis of countless dishes. It can be baked, boiled, mashed, fried, or roasted, lending itself to an array of culinary techniques and flavors. Whether it’s a simple side dish or the centerpiece of a feast, the potato offers a wide range of culinary possibilities.

There are many varieties of potatoes, each with its distinct characteristics, from their color, shape, and texture to their flavor and culinary applications. Russet potatoes, with their thick brown skin and mealy texture, are ideal for baking and frying. Red potatoes, with their thin, red skin and waxy texture, hold their shape well when boiled or roasted. Fingerling potatoes, small and elongated, offer a unique texture and flavor, perfect for roasting or grilling. Each variety displays a distinct arrangement of “eyes,” adding to the individuality of the plant.

Potential Problems and Considerations

Common Issues with Potatoes

Even though growing potatoes is a relatively simple process, there are factors that need to be considered for optimal results. Awareness of potential problems can ensure a healthy harvest.

Disease is a common enemy. One of the most serious threats to potato cultivation is potato blight, a fungal disease that can devastate entire crops. Early detection and appropriate treatment are critical. This can include choosing disease-resistant varieties, ensuring proper air circulation, and using fungicides.

Premature sprouting can be another challenge. Potatoes that are stored for extended periods can begin to sprout, even before they are planted. Proper storage is essential to prevent this. Store potatoes in a cool, dark, and dry place, away from sunlight. Avoid storing them with apples, as apples release ethylene gas, which can stimulate sprouting.

What about potatoes that have already started to sprout? In small quantities, potatoes with small sprouts are usually safe to eat, as long as the sprouts and any green areas are removed. However, older, heavily sprouted potatoes can accumulate higher levels of solanine, a toxic compound. Eating large amounts of solanine can lead to illness. If a potato has many eyes with long sprouts, it is best to discard it.

Safety should always be a priority. When handling potatoes, it is important to be aware of potential hazards. The green skin and any green areas of the potato contain solanine, which, as mentioned earlier, can be toxic. Avoid eating potatoes with green areas. Peel the potatoes before cooking and eating them to remove the skin.
